Door Reinforcement for Stonecrest Homes

Door reinforcement in Stonecrest starts at $180 and runs to $400 for a full jamb and strike-plate upgrade. The original installations in 1980s and 1990s DeKalb County subdivices often used short screws, thin strike plates, and un-reinforced jambs that fail under forced entry. We install steel strike boxes, 3-inch screws into framing studs, and wrap plates that distribute force across the jamb.

This work is especially important for Stonecrest homeowners who travel, who have basement or walkout entrances obscured by landscaping, or who simply want the door to hold long enough for help to arrive. We assess your specific door, frame, and hinge setup, then quote a flat price before any work begins.

Common Residential Locksmith Problems We See in Stonecrest Homes

  • Seasonal deadbolt binding from humid summers. Stonecrest’s humid subtropical climate swells wood door frames from June through September. Deadbolts that threw smoothly in spring suddenly need shoulder pressure to turn. We adjust strike-plate alignment and shim frames to account for this annual cycle, not just file the bolt and hope.
  • Misaligned latches on 1980s-1990s door prep. Original installations in Stonecrest subdivisions often used standard latch sizes on doors with non-standard bore spacing or shallow mortises. A new lock installed without checking these dimensions will stick, fail to throw fully, or wear out the internal mechanism within months.
  • Frame drift in slab-foundation homes. Georgia red-clay soil settles unevenly under slab foundations common to Stonecrest’s 1980s and 1990s builds. Door frames shift gradually. A lock installed without a torque test and frame shimming may work day one and lock the door shut by month six.
  • Worn original hardware hitting end-of-life. The bulk of Stonecrest’s residential stock is now 30-40 years old. Original Kwikset and Schlage deadbolts from the 1980s and 1990s have internal springs and pins that simply wear out. We see key extraction calls, broken tailpieces, and cylinders that won’t accept a new key cut to code. Replacement is the only reliable fix.
